Hazelwood Crime: Female Victim Sexually Assaulted by Ex-Friend, Stolen Gas and Leaf Blowers
Plus, cases of domestic assault, trespassing, stealing and more.
Here’s a rundown of crime that occurred in the City of Hazelwood between Aug. 21-22. Hazelwood Patch attained the accounts from the Hazelwood Police Department.

- Stealing: Two leaf blowers were stolen in the 4800 block of Heritage Heights. Police have identified a suspect and the investigation continues.
- Sexual Assault: A female victim told police that she was inappropriately touched by an ex-friend in the 6000 block of Lindbergh. Police are investigating the situation.
- Drugs: A traffic stop at the intersection of Lynn Haven and Town & Country resulted in police locating drugs in the vehicle.
- Stealing: Suspects stole gas from a station in the 6000 block of Howdershell.
- Domestic Assault: A man was arrested after assaulting a female victim in the 300 block of Avant.
- Trespassing: Two suspects drove a vehicle through a private property in the 4600 block of Aubuchon.
